Every May, the commune of Bagnac-sur-Célé (46270), nestled in the Célé valley between Figeac and the Causses forest, celebrates the arrival of spring with one of its most anticipated events: the Flower Fair, Flea Market, and Car Boot Sale. Organized by the Association des Commerçants et Artisans de Bagnac (ACAB), this event marks the beginning of the summer season for residents and visitors to this beautiful Lot valley.
The unique aspect of this event lies in its dual nature. On one hand, producers and nursery owners offer a wide selection of vegetable plants, annual and perennial flowers, herbs, and ornamental plants – everything you need to adorn gardens, terraces, and balconies as the warmer weather approaches. On the other hand, flea market vendors and individuals display their second-hand items, furniture, tableware, books, clothing, and curiosities of all kinds.
The event takes place on Avenue Joseph Canteloube and Place du Foirail, which transform into a colorful market for the day. Between 50 and 100 exhibitors – depending on the year – liven up this vast space. Treasure hunters and lovers of beautiful plants mingle in a festive and relaxed atmosphere, characteristic of Quercy village fairs.
The Bagnac-sur-Célé Flower Fair doesn't just offer plants and items: it celebrates the flavors of the Lot region with the sale of fouaces and pompes, traditional Quercy brioche breads that are a delight at local festivals. Food and drinks are also available on-site to accompany this pleasant day of strolling.
Bagnac-sur-Célé is a charming commune in the northeast of the Lot, crossed by the Célé river, a tributary of the Lot, set amidst limestone cliffs and forests. The village is an ideal starting point for exploring the Célé valley and its treasures (prehistoric caves, hilltop villages, hiking trails). The May fair is the perfect opportunity to visit this still-preserved territory.
The Foire aux Fleurs, Brocante et Vide-Grenier of Bagnac-sur-Célé is held every May, on a Sunday, from 8 am to 7 pm. Entry is free for visitors. Pitches are available for exhibitors (professionals and individuals). Food, drinks, and local product sales on-site. Parking nearby.
